Division in the Body: Align with God
The Theme for this week’s devotionals is “Division in the Body in Home, Marriages, and Friends” a topic for which Pastor Wayne Cockrell has consistently asked the body of Christ to be in prayer. Be encouraged by today’s devotional and please continue to pray with us.

SCRIPTURE: “I appeal to you, dear brothers and sisters, by the authority of our Lord Jesus Christ, to live in harmony with each other. Let there be no divisions in the church. Rather, be of one mind, united in thought and purpose.” 1 Corinthians 1:10
This loving and forgiving God we serve is omniscient and He has set some determinations that
He has connected to His laws and promises. All of what He has determined never conflicts
with His plan and purposes for us. He is never a God of confusion. He is a God of order and
He has said some things to the body to ensure we exemplify unity with Him. Let us look at
principles presented to entities (where we abide) including in the home, in our relationships and in marriage.
Home
Proverbs 24:3, says “By wisdom a house is built, and by understanding it is established;” and
Joshua said it like this, “as for me and my house, we will serve the Lord” (Joshua 24:15b). To
serve the Lord would include principles such as, Prayer, Praise, Worship, Fast, and Tithe to the
Father. God desires that all who are in the same household practice faith principles, trust in
Him; and align with what brings Him pleasure.
Friends
2 Corinthians 6:14, teaches that we as believers should “not be yoked together with
unbelievers.” This helps us decide who should be our friends (those we confide in or listen to);
who should be our fiancé or spouse (marry); and with whom should we have any binding relationship
(contractual). For by definition “what does light have to do with darkness; and what does
righteousness have to do with unrighteousness?” (2 Corinthians 6:14)
Marriage
Ephesians 5:22-24, reveals ”Wives should submit to their own husbands, as to the Lord. For
the husband is to be the head of the wife even as Christ is the head of the church, His body,
and He is their Savior.” Then Ephesians 5:25-27 and Colossians 3:19, God teaches that the
husband must love His wife kindly, unconditionally, sacrificially, patiently (just as Christ loves
the church); and in I Peter 3:7, we find that if he does not do so, he will be hindered spiritually.
God desires that we have adequate protection and safety whether it be at home, in marriage or
in any other relationship; therefore, He never leaves us without direction. In Joshua, we find
the way to have a life of “good success” is to “meditate therein day and night, that you may
observe to do according to all that is written in scripture.” (Joshua 1:8).
Prayer: Lord, thank You for Your provision and protection in scripture. We find that we are nothing without You; that we should depend upon You for everything. Help us to OBEY You; and seek You FIRST in all matters of life; that we may bring You honor and glory; and thereby, experience “success”. In Jesus’ Name-Amen!
